GC Cares-a-Thon
It was wonderful to see so many of our middle school families at the GC Cares-a-thon on Friday, 1/31. The event was a huge success, with 235 student volunteers and over 300 participants. Our students spent countless hours preparing stations to inform the community about their chosen causes and charities, and their hard work was apparent on Friday. Board Games
The middle school is seeking new or gently used board games to make available for our students during homebase. We hope that the games will provide an opportunity for students to socialize, work together and have some fun. A few donations have already rolled in and I’m told that they are a huge hit. Homebase is fairly short, so think games that can be played quickly. If you want to purchase new and need ideas, check our wish list. That said, as long as games are in good shape and contain all the pieces, we are happy to accept them! Games can be dropped outside the front doors of the Middle School in the bin labeled ‘Donations’.
